About PACE

Philanthropists Gary and Mary West founded West Health with the mission of enabling seniors to successfully age in place with access to high-quality, affordable health and support services that preserve and protect their dignity, quality of life, and independence.

The Gary and Mary West PACE (Program of All-inclusive Care for the Elderly), affiliated with West Health (www.westhealth.org), is a non-profit that delivers medical, social, and behavioral services to the frail elderly to the North County of San Diego. This PACE center is entrepreneurial in nature and focuses on innovations and bringing new processes to the traditional PACE environment.

Position Summary:

Under the direction of the Center Manager, the PACE Care Navigator is responsible for supporting the IDT by coordinating the Service Delivery Request process and documenting the meeting discussions. As an integral member of the Retention Committee, the Care Navigator also provides direct assistance to participants by connecting them to PACE system of care and proactively reaches out to participants to resolve concerns to prevent disenrollment. Communicates appropriately to the interdisciplinary team members, management, and participants to resolve concerns. Promotes professional working relationships with both internal and external customers. Adheres to and supports all organizational policies and procedures and standards.

Essential Functions:
  • Participate in IDT meetings and provide support to the IDT.
  • Scribes IDT meeting agenda for each pride and assists with coordinating meeting.
  • Coordinates transportation schedule in IDT and tracks cancellations.
  • Manages Service Delivery Requests to include initiation in EMR, documentation, NOA letters for denials, and service provided dates.
  • Collaborates with medical assistant scheduler for centralized assessment and transportation scheduling.
  • Leads Retention Committee and acts as a liaison between different disciplines, services, and participants to ensure continuity of care and services.
  • Interfaces directly with participants identified as being at risk for disenrollment from the program.
  • Clarifies areas of need, available resources, and sources of support, and develops a plan in collaboration with IDT members and the participants, participants families/caregivers.
  • Facilitates communication among service providers, family, participants, caregivers.
